#f1b724 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f1b724 is composed of 94.5% red, 71.8%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.1% magenta, 85.1%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 43 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 54.3%. #f1b724 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ff48 with #e36f00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#f1b724 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f1b724 has RGB values of R:241, G:183,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.85,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15841060.

Shades and Tints of #f1b724
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020200 is the darkest color, while #fefaef is the lightest one.

Tones of #f1b724
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e8c87 is the less saturated color, while #fabb1b is the most saturated one.
